ºÚÁϹÙÍø Podcast: How new technologies impact international student employability

Listen in as ºÚÁϹÙÍø’s Craig Riggs and Martijn van de Veen recap some recent industry developments with a focus on three key international education trends for 2025.

This month's episode features a conversation – with Sue Attewell, Head of AI at , and Puneet Kohli, Chief Executive Officer at – exploring how new technologies and digital innovations are impacting career services for international students and their employability.

We conclude with a closer look at Japan as the latest stop for our “Keys to the Market” segment.
